Common causes of hemorrhoids include repeated straining with bowel movements, prolonged standing or sitting, heavy lifting with straining, and pregnancy. Procedures include ligation (tying off hemorrhoid with a rubber band to strangulate it); sclerotherapy (injection of chemical to induce scarring); cryosurgery (freezing the hemorrhoid with liquid nitrogen); coagulation (by infrared light or laser) or hemorrhoidectomy (surgical removal). Lose weight if you are overweight. Call if you have any questions or concerns. Hemorrhoids are swollen blood vessels in and around the anus. There are two types of hemorrhoids: Internal and external. Hemorrhoids, also called 'piles', are enlarged, or varicose, veins of the anus and rectum. Depending upon the location and severity of the problem, health care providers today use the following treatment approaches in dealing with hemorrhoids: Conservative measures: A dietary regimen with fiber supplements and self-help treatments is helpful in most cases, except in instances where a hemorrhoid has thrombosed.
